About WELL Welltower Inc.

Welltower owns a diversified healthcare portfolio of 2,800 in-place properties spread across the senior housing, medical office, and skilled nursing/postacute care sectors. The portfolio includes over 900 properties in Canada and the United Kingdom as the company looks for additional investment opportunities in countries with mature healthcare systems that operate similarly to that of the United States.

About SPOT Spotify Technology S.A.

Spotify is the leading global music streaming service, with over 750 million monthly active users and nearly 300 million paying subscribers, with the latter constituting the firm's premium segment. Most of the firm's revenue and nearly all its gross profit come from subscribers, who pay a monthly fee to access a music library that includes most of the most popular songs ever recorded, including all from the major record labels. The firm also offers access to audiobooks and integrates podcasts within its standard music app. Podcast content is not exclusive and is typically free to access on other platforms. Ad-supported users can access a similar music catalog, but cannot customize a similar on-demand experience.
